Output f65d2efdcb34a51a2e3e0e12839daf95a23af511e199c570f2a4e0f4aa8b4e29:0

value
6400874
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 442d1173b6fe7332f96ac63cbe503c9c8c565bff OP_EQUALVERIFY OP_CHECKSIG
address
17DUwSHY9jfQuaME2viSdS7DJejQkS51ZD
transaction
f65d2efdcb34a51a2e3e0e12839daf95a23af511e199c570f2a4e0f4aa8b4e29
confirmations
432854
spent
true